ABSTRACT

Interdisciplinary therapy was used to treat a patient missing a single posterior tooth opposing an extruded tooth. The simple technique used a removable interocclusal device and elastic band for orthodontic intrusion over a 2-month period after implant placement in the opposing arch to aid in prosthetic site development. This approach was designed to increase the interocclusal space needed to restore the implant, obtain a more consistent occlusal plane, and improve esthetics. Clinical and radiographic examinations at the 6-month follow-up revealed an acceptable occlusal relationship and improved esthetic appearance that was achieved with the documented course of treatment.
